SCHOOL VISION: A.J. Moore is designed to prepare students for success


in post secondary education and in the workplace. Students are
prepared to excel academically, physically and socially. Special
emphasis is placed on business, engineering, entrepreneurship,
technology, and post-secondary education.

GOAL: The purpose of this study is to determine and develop a positive behavior support
system and program that uses best practices to deter negative student behavior in the school
setting including classrooms and any campus grounds.
